# Heads up for whoever reviews this: the Ledgerbee billing worker runs
# blue-green, so two copies of this client can be live during a cutover.
# Both colors hit the same Tollgate internal API, which means the key below
# must stay valid across the swap — don't rotate it mid-deploy or the green
# side starts bouncing invoices. Rotation is fine once traffic is fully
# drained from blue. The client reads its credential from the line directly
# below this comment.

API key for tagef-fafop: vxb2-ta

Handover: notification fan-out backpressure (Bellwick Notify)

Hey folks — passing this to support before I'm out. The fan-out workers were drowning during the Tuesday spike, so we added a backpressure valve that pauses low-priority pushes when the queue tops 50k. If customers report delayed alerts, that's probably it kicking in — totally expected, clears within minutes. Dashboards show a yellow banner when it's active. One more thing: the queue admin vault got re-sealed during the change, and the new recovery passphrase is right below.

vault phrase of bagaf-kajeg = jorath-feniel-briir-siliel-ralix

// REINDEX_BATCH_CAP limits docs per shard pass in the Tallowfield
// nightly search reindex. Raising it starves the ingest queue;
// lowering it overruns the maintenance window. 5000 is the tested
// sweet spot. Change only with a soak run. Verified against the
// build noted below.

session token of bawif-hahog = htk6_ac5981